0:55Now PlayingThe stench of the “Weinstein Effect” is still lingering Monday, five years after mainstream reports of Harvey Weinstein’s dark sexual reign of terror first came to light.
Author Ken Auletta’s bombshell new book, “Hollywood Ending: Harvey Weinstein and the Culture of Silence,” dives deep into the ugly truth of the disgraced film producer’s downfall.
“[He] had some notion in his head that his body was attractive,” the author, 80, told Fox News, despite witness testimony that he smelled of feces, had genitals scarred to the point they “looked like a vagina” and a back full of “uncomfortable” blackheads.
